Princeton's WordNet

  1. wingstem, golden ironweed, yellow ironweed, golden honey plant, Verbesina alternifolia, Actinomeris alternifolianoun

    perennial herb with showy yellow flowers; the eastern United States

Wikipedia

  1. wingstem

    Verbesina alternifolia is a species of flowering plant in the family Asteraceae. It is commonly known as wingstem or yellow ironweed. It is native to North America.It is a larval host to the gold moth (Basilodes pepita) and the silvery checkerspot (Chlosyne nycteis).

  1. wingstem

    Wingstem is a commonly used name for Verbesina alternifolia, a type of perennial plant native to North America. This plant is characterized by its yellow, daisy-like flowers and tall, erect stem which has wing-like appendages, hence the name Wingstem. It is usually found in woodlands, thickets, and along banks and roadsides.
